我将在服务器端和客户端都将自举的代码放在哪里?我在两端都需要一些逻辑,并且不想在多个地方维护它。我尝试过/考虑过:
- 将其添加到
src/components/_app.js
中,constructor
但这似乎只能在客户端执行(或者对于getInitialsProps
服务器端还不够早)。 - 将其添加到
_app.js
constructor
和中server.js
,尽管这意味着我的逻辑不能使用模块系统,import
因为server.js
它不是那样编译的。
我将在服务器端和客户端都将自举的代码放在哪里?我在两端都需要一些逻辑,并且不想在多个地方维护它。我尝试过/考虑过:
src/components/_app.js
中,constructor
但这似乎只能在客户端执行(或者对于getInitialsProps
服务器端还不够早)。_app.js
constructor
和中server.js
,尽管这意味着我的逻辑不能使用模块系统,import
因为server.js
它不是那样编译的。